Barcelona Make Initial Contact With Aymeric Laporte Who Want To Leave Man City In The Summer

Manchester City defender Aymeric Laporte is keen on leaving the club in the summer and is prioritising a transfer to FC Barcelona.

It is further claimed that the two parties have already made initial contacts to inform each other of their willingness to carry out the operation in the summer. However, any move would be subject to Barça’s Financial Fair Play issues being dealt with effectively.

Laporte has been on Barça’s radars for a while now. Links over a move had surfaced in the past few transfer windows but never amounted to anything.

But, there could be a major opportunity for the Blaugrana this summer as the Spanish international is understood to be disappointed with his lack of prominence in Pep Guardiola’s side in England, with the likes of Ruben Dias and Nathan Ake being favoured more.

Hence, it is being claimed that Laporte is looking for an exit in the next transfer window and sees a move to Barcelona as an ideal switch.

The Blaugrana, for their part, are aware of the former Athletic Club star’s preference and have already started working in the background over a possible transfer in the summer.

A left-footed centre-half was something that Xavi and the management were keen on signing before next season. Athletic Club’s Inigo Martinez is a player that they were looking at but his age and fitness had raised some concerns.

That, coupled with Laporte’s potential availability, has led to Barcelona reducing their interest in Martinez and focusing on the Manchester City ace.

There has been contact between the club’s sports department and Laporte’s entourage to affirm each other’s interests in the move. However, at the same time, the move would only be feasible if City let him leave for an affordable fee and the FFP issues at Barça are resolved.

After all, La Liga president Javier Tebas recently warned Barcelona that they might not be allowed to sign any players unless their wage bill is drastically reduced.

Manchester City, for their part, have been happy to let players leave if they do not wish to stay at Etihad. So, Laporte, whose contract runs until 2025, could be allowed to depart as long as Barcelona’s offer is deemed acceptable.

The operation is at a very nascent stage and it will certainly be interesting to see how things progress in the coming weeks. Apart from Laporte, Barça also hold an interest in two other Man City stars in Bernardo Silva and Ilkay Gundogan.
